Abstract

From the temperature‐dependent HPLC retention of a guest or host on a chemically bonded stationary phase containing the complementary component (as shown schematically on the right), the complexation enthalpies of a series of hydrogen‐bonded host‐guest complexes can be rapidly and conveniently determined. The ΔH̊ values determined in this way agree within experimental error with the complexation enthalpies measured in free solution by traditional methods. (Figure Presented.)
